Holiday Bikes


Just a quick share of holiday bike cards for some friends who absolutely love bikes. There was no way I could send them any other kind of card. These ones use Papertrey Ink's Pedal Pusher stamp set and coordinating dies. I used the Simon Says Stamp Falling Snow stencil with modeling paste for the snowy background, Wink of Stella to glitter up the holly leaves and Copic markers (25% off right now!) to create quick shadows under the wheels.
